轨道交通高架混凝土结构表面涂装方案的经济技术分析

摘  要:对轨道交通高架混凝土结构表面涂装方案,从耐久性和景观需求出发分析其必要性,从工程造价、防护效果、使用年限、耐久性等方面对其常用方案进行经济技术分析,并举例说明其在两座城市轨道交通工程中的实践。分析表明:轨道交通高架结构表面涂装主要是基于提高耐久性和城市景观的需求;表面涂装方案应纳入高架景观专题进行经济技术比选;建议选用耐久性使用年限长的涂装方案,其中水性涂料涂装方案施工简单、性价比高、安全环保。This study analyzes the necessities of surface coating on the concrete structure of an elevated rail transit from landscape needs and durability requirements. Moreover, it compares and analyzes common coating schemes from the perspective of engineering cost, protective effect, service life, durability, and so on. The application of surface coating to two railway transit projects is also introduced herein. The results show that the main reasons for the surface coating selection are largely based on enhancing concrete durability and urban landscape demands. An economic and technical comparison of the surface coating schemes should be included in a specific study of the urban viaduct landscape. A cost-effective, safe, and environmentally-friendly coating scheme with a long service life, and in which waterborne coating is convenient to construct, is recommended.
